Passive Convention Center
Role
Project Designer
Software Used
Revit, Rhino, Grasshopper, Climate Consultant, WUFI, THERM, Falcon CFD, Photoshop, Illustrator, InDesign
Deliverables
Design Proposal
Through an integration of local environmental and cultural conditions the project seeks to bring a deeper purpose to downtown Lafayette. Mimicking the local ecology of mima mounds - mounds of sediment that often form in areas with high water tables - the different levels of terracing are orchestrated through sinking the exhibit halls, the architecture lending itself to shape the landscape. Further emphasizing the gateway are structural cables for the Convention Center roofs which serve a three-fold purpose of reducing truss depths, creating a solar chimney and producing an iconic shade canopy. Utilizing passive systems in the highly humid climate is difficult, but is achieved part of the year through a combination of vegetation, desiccant-based water features, natural ventilation and large shade structures.
